Find a wall stud using a stud finder or by gently tapping the wall until you hear a solid rather than a hollow sound.

Metal toggle bolts can support heavy loads 25 pounds to 50 pounds in drywall plaster and hollow core concrete block.
Use a stud finder to check and if this is the case you can nail or screw directly into the stud to hold the weight of the picture.
